Capo D'Acqua Lake is a lake inside a private property, part of the National Park of Gran Sasso and Monti della Laga.
It's a spring water lake created in the 60s for the irrigation of nearby fields. Because of its spring water, offers excellent visibility and a unique lakeside flora.
In the vicinity of these streams were generated, roughly in the Middle Ages, two mills and a paint factory. Today, the paint factory building is still visible on the surface, while the two mills are flooded.
The first is in the worst condition, but it still shows the wheel that operated the mill, not inconsiderable charm. The second is more beautiful and charming with other underwater environments, can all be visited.
